This song was performed in a movie called "Dark City" a science fiction movie from 1998. It was directed by Alex Proyas and its screenplay was written by Proyas, Lem Dobbs, and David S. Goyer. Rufus Sewell, Kiefer Sutherland, Jennifer Connelly, Richard O'Brien, and William Hurt were the casts of this movie.

"Sway" was originally by Frank Sinatra and Dean Martin and here in this scene of the movie it was performed by Jennifer Connelly. she did a pretty good performance and her vocal fits well on this song (as she is an actress, her vocal's tone was already prepared) and we can hear the real emotion in her voice.

The song contains Electric Guitars (Clean/Distorted), piano, percussion, Bass, Drums. Bassline and Guitar lines are amazing and I really enjoyed listening to them, also the piano piece added a nice feeling to the whole song (with vocal answer melodies and adding space by low chords), in some parts electric guitar is performing melodies like western songs. the way the vocalist is singing high notes (softly) made it sound warm and heartful. though she doesn't perform vibration in the notes she was performing but still it sounds good and unique.

The video shows Connely standing on a stage with a band performing behind her and the location is a small bar with audiences watching and listening to her.
